Westcliffe sits at about 8,700 feet, so the air is a little thinner than usual. Drink plenty of water, take it easy the first day, and pace yourself with drinks. The venue will have oxygen, plenty of water, and altitude patches on hand if you need a little extra help. We’ll also have assistance available for short walks around the venue for anyone who might have difficulty with the altitude. Listen to your body, and you’ll be ready to celebrate, dance, and enjoy every Colorado moment!
